Grammar Patterns

V/A-stem + 았어요 (ㅏ/ㅗ) Past Tense — Bright Vowel

若动词或形容词词干最后的元音是ㅏ或ㅗ,加上았어요构成礼貌过去式。开音节相同元音相遇时会缩约(가다→갔어요)。

가다 → 갔어요 — to go → went
gada → gasseoyo
오다 → 왔어요 — to come → came
oda → wasseoyo
좋다 → 좋았어요 — to be good → was good
jota → joasseoyo
V/A-stem + 었어요 (other vowels) Past Tense — Dark Vowel

若词干最后元音不是ㅏ或ㅗ,加上었어요。开音节会与词尾缩约(마시다→마셨어요、주다→줬어요)。

먹다 → 먹었어요 — to eat → ate
meokda → meogeosseoyo
마시다 → 마셨어요 — to drink → drank
masida → masyeosseoyo
주다 → 줬어요 — to give → gave
juda → jwosseoyo
N + 하다 → N + 했어요 Past Tense — 하다 Verbs

所有하다动词和形容词的过去式都是했어요(하+였어요缩约)。如공부하다。

공부하다 → 공부했어요 — to study → studied
gongbuhada → gongbuhaesseoyo
사랑하다 → 사랑했어요 — to love → loved
saranghada → saranghaesseoyo
운동하다 → 운동했어요 — to exercise → exercised
undonghada → undonghaesseoyo
ㄷ·ㅂ irregular + 았/었어요 Past Tense — ㄷ / ㅂ Irregulars

ㄷ不规则在元音前ㄷ变ㄹ(듣다→들었어요)。ㅂ不规则ㅂ变우再缩约(춥다→추웠어요)。

듣다 → 들었어요 — to listen → listened
deutda → deureosseoyo
걷다 → 걸었어요 — to walk → walked
geotda → georeosseoyo
춥다 → 추웠어요 — to be cold → was cold
chupda → chuwosseoyo
ㅡ·르 irregular + 았/었어요 Past Tense — ㅡ / 르 Irregulars

ㅡ不规则去掉ㅡ,按前一元音选았/었(바쁘다→바빴어요)。르不规则ㅡ脱落并加ㄹ(모르다→몰랐어요)。

바쁘다 → 바빴어요 — to be busy → was busy
bappeuda → bappasseoyo
쓰다 → 썼어요 — to write → wrote
sseuda → sseosseoyo
모르다 → 몰랐어요 — to not know → didn't know
moreuda → mollasseoyo
